Description
On tutorials/actually-using-git/lessons/conflicting-branches.md , there are three reasonable ways to initialize a repo:
1. Reuse an existing repo
2. Create a new repo on Github and then clone it
3. Use `git init`
If a participant uses the third option (`git init`) and then, following the directions, immediately tries to create a new branch, they'll get an error:
```
fatal: Not a valid object name: 'master'.
```
Instead, they should create a dummy `readme.md`, add and commit it, and then proceed.
The instructions should be clarified for folks who choose the third option.
